Emerging Travel Trends Impacting AARP Travel
Several significant trends will shape the future of travel for AARP’s target demographic. The rise of experiential travel, focusing on unique and immersive experiences rather than simply sightseeing, is prominent. Sustainability is another key factor, with more travelers prioritizing eco-friendly options and responsible tourism. Finally, the increasing demand for personalized and customized travel itineraries tailored to individual needs and preferences is undeniable. These trends present both opportunities and challenges for AARP Travel.

Leveraging Technology for Enhanced Services
Technology will play a pivotal role in improving AARP Travel’s services and customer experience. A user-friendly mobile app, offering seamless booking, itinerary management, real-time support, and personalized recommendations, is essential. AI-powered chatbots can provide 24/7 customer service, addressing queries and resolving issues efficiently. Virtual reality (VR) technology could be used to offer immersive previews of destinations and accommodations, allowing travelers to virtually experience their trips before booking. Data analytics can be leveraged to understand customer preferences better and personalize marketing campaigns, improving the overall customer journey.
